Property Description for 101 Central Park West, 4-A

From the moment you enter the majestic foyer you will be in awe of the grand scale of this spectacular seven room residence. The 30' living/dining room has a wood-burning fireplace and three south-facing windows. The dreamy library also faces south and has gorgeous high gloss, custom built-ins and bespoke mahogany doors made by a master craftsman. There are three bedrooms including the spacious master that offers a walk-in closet and a marble en-suite bathroom with a separate stall shower and tub.

The apartment was beautifully renovated and thoughtfully reconfigured so it now has a fabulous eat-in kitchen with a large dining area, lots of storage and counter space, top appliances, a washer/dryer, desk and a cozy window seat.

This lovely home also has soaring ceilings, walls of custom closets and of course central A/C.

101 Central Park West is one of the finest white glove, full-service, pet-friendly cooperatives in the city with a state-of-the-art gym, storage bins and a bike room. Central Park is right outside your door and fabulous shopping and top restaurants are around the corner. Board will now consider pied-a-terre's on a case-by-case basis and 50% max financing.

Central Park West | Manhattan

Quick Profile

Home to some of New York City’s most famous buildings like The Dakota, with its enchanting architecture, and the equally impressive San Remo just a couple streets away, Central Park West is one of the most eye-popping neighborhoods to live in. 

It is historically renowned for its blending of architecture and residential living. So much so, that it earned a listing on the National Register of Historic Places in 1982. It is thought to have some of the most diverse and beautiful skylines in all of New York and has drawn celebrity residents for decades

If world-class architecture isn’t enough for you, there are plenty of warm brownstones to be found as well. There is so much to do in Central Park West, the most obvious being in the name of the neighborhood itself. With Central Park running the length of one of its borders, there’s easy access to the park and all its wonders, running trails, row boats, and bridges. If you prefer the indoors, the American Museum of Natural History is at your service. 

There are few places in the world that can match Central Park West’s varied combination of urban and residential charm, elegance, and spirit.
